Gradual Weight Loss for Weight Management

Losing weight, especially a significant amount like 15 kilograms, is a gradual process. Aim for a gradual weight loss of about 0.5 to 1 kilogram per week. This can be achieved through a balanced diet and increased physical activity. It's important to set realistic goals, stay consistent, and seek support from healthcare professionals or nutritionists. Small, Sustainable Changes Lead to Big Results

The key to successful long-term weight loss is making small, sustainable changes to your lifestyle. Begin by incorporating more fruits and vegetables into your meals, and find enjoyable ways to stay active. Small, consistent steps can lead to significant progress over time. For example, try reducing your calorie intake by 500-750 calories below your baseline to achieve about 0.45 to 0.9 kilograms per week.

Effective Strategies for Weight Loss

To lose 15 kilograms effectively, focus on three key areas:

1. Creating a Calorie Deficit

Center your diet on nutrient-dense foods while reducing your overall calorie intake. Aim to consume fewer calories than your body burns. This can be achieved by portion control and including a variety of f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ains in your meals. Eating a balanced diet ensures you get essential nutrients while reducing your calorie intake.

2. Regular Physical Activity

Engage in regular physical activity to support your efforts. Aim to combine a mix of cardiovascular exercises, such as brisk walking, running, or cycling, with strength training.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ic activity per week, or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ity activity. Regular exercise helps improve your metabolism and builds muscle, which can aid in calorie burning.

3. Consistency and Progress Monitoring

Stay consistent with your routines and track your progress. Establish a feasible daily schedule and regularly monitor your food consumption, exercise routine, and weight loss goals. You can boost your motivation by setting small, achievable milestones. Don't hesitate to seek professional advice or support from a healthcare provider or a registered dietitian if you need it.
